        진동자극이 뇌졸중 환자의 편측무시에 미치는 효과 : 개별사례연구

        박진혁,박지혁 대한작업치료학회 2016 대한작업치료학회지 Vol.24 No.1

        목적 : 본 연구의 목적은 진동자극이 뇌졸중 환자의 편측무시에 미치는 효과를 알아보는 것이다. 연구방법 : 본 연구는 편측무시를 보이는 뇌졸중 환자 3명을 대상으로 하였다. 다중 기초선 개별사례연구 설계를 사용하였으며, 연구기간 동안 대상자별 실험설계는, 대상자 1은 기초선 5회, 중재기 15회, 대상자 2는 기초선 7회, 중재기 13회, 대상자 3은 기초선 9회, 중재기 11로 대상자간 기초선과 중재기 회기 수는 다르나 총 회기 수는 20회로 동일하였다. 각 중재기 동안 진동자극기를 이용하여 대상자의 왼쪽 전완부에 진동자극을 회기 당 30분씩 적용하였다. 기초선과 중재기간에는 편측무시 평가를 위해 선 나누기 검사(Line Bisection Test; LBT)와 알버트 검사(Albert’s test)를 시행하였고 중재 전, 후로 일상 생활에서의 편측무시를 평가하기 위해 Catherine Bergego Scale (CBS)을 사용하였다. 결과 : 왼쪽 전완부에 진동자극 후 모든 대상자에서 중재 전과 비교하여 LBT, 알버트 검사, CBS 점수가 향상되어 편측무시가 감소되었다. 결론 : 본 연구 결과, 왼쪽 전완부의 진동자극은 뇌졸중 환자의 편측무시 감소에 긍정적인 영향을 준 것으로 확인되었다. Objective: The purpose of this study was to verify the effects of vibration stimulation on the unilateral neglect in patients after a stroke. Methods: A single-subject research method using multiple baselines across the individuals was employed in this study. All subjects who showed unilateral neglect caused by a stroke received vibration stimulation applied to their left forearm for 30 minutes per sessions. A total of 20 sessions were conducted. Their unilateral neglect was measured through a Line Bisection test and Albert’s test during each session, and the Catherine Bergego Scale was used to evaluate the degree of unilateral neglect based on the pre-and post-test on their daily life. The data were visually analyzed using graphs and a descriptive statistical analysis. Results: All subjects showed statistically significant improvements in the Line Bisection test and Albert’s test scores, and the Catherine Bergego Scale scores were improved post-test. Conclusions: The results of this study indicate that vibration stimulation has a positive effect on the unilateral neglect, and may be considered an alternative choice in clinical occupational therapy for reducing unilateral neglect.

      • 도로 주행 능력을 향상시키기 위한 운전재활의 체계적 고찰

        박진혁,허서윤,서준,박지혁 대한신경계작업치료학회 2016 재활치료과학 Vol.5 No.2

        목적: 본 연구의 목적은 도로 주행 능력을 향상시키기 위한 운전재활의 방법과 효과에 대해 체계적 고찰 을 통하여 추후에 있을 운전재활 연구의 방향을 제시하고자 한다. 연구방법: 2014년 12월부터 2015년 1월까지 운전재활에 관한 연구를 CINAHL, Embase, Pubmed, PsycINFO, Riss를 통하여 검색하였다. 선정기준에 따라 최종적으로 15편의 연구를 분석하였으며 주요 검색용어로는 “On-road” OR “Driving” AND “Driving rehabilitation”AND “Intervention”을 사용하 였다. 결과: 고찰한 연구는 총 15개로 근거 수준은 , , 이었다. 연구대상은 뇌졸중 환자(40.0%), 고령 운 전자(20.0%), 외상성 뇌손상 환자(20.0%), 후천적 뇌손상 환자(13.3%), 척수환자(6.7%)였으며, 실제 도로 주행 능력을 향상시키기 위한 중재 방법은 시뮬레이터를 이용한 훈련(53.3%), 인지 기술을 훈련 (26.6%), 운전을 위한 교육(6.7%), 보조 기기의 적용(6.7%), 운전 연수(6.7%)이었다. 중재 효과는 방법 에 따라 차이가 있었지만 시뮬레이터를 이용한 모든 연구에서 중재 후 도로 주행 능력의 유의한 향상을 보고하였다. 결론: 도로 주행 능력을 향상시키기 위한 운전재활은 다양한 방법으로 적용되고 있었다. 특히 시뮬레이터 를 이용한 중재는 많은 연구를 통해 효과가 입증되고 있었다. 추후 다양한 연구 대상자와 중재 방법을 통해 도로 주행 능력 향상을 위한 운전재활 연구가 지속적으로 이루어져야 할 것이다.

        Development and Application of Distributed Rainfall-Runoff Model Using MPI Technique

        박진혁,허영택 대한토목학회 2011 KSCE JOURNAL OF CIVIL ENGINEERING Vol.15 No.6

        A lumped model, in general, is expressed by ordinary differential equations, which does not take into account the spatial variability of processes, input, boundary conditions and watershed geometric characteristics. For this reason, recently distributed run-off models have been developed to represent the variability in physical watershed characteristics such as topography, land use, and rainfall properties. However, the distributed rainfall-runoff model requires a lot of time and effort to generate input data. Also, it takes a lot of time to calculate the discharge using a numerical analysis based on kinematic wave theory in runoff process. Therefore, most river basins that use the distributed model are of limited scales, such as small river basins. Especially, the necessity for an integrated watershed management system has been increasing due to changes in watershed management concepts and discharge calculations for whole river basins, including the upstream and downstream of dams. In this study, a distributed rainfall-runoff model using Message Passing Interface (MPI) technique was developed to decrease the calculation time needed for the application of large scale watersheds. This model, which uses a parallelized based K-water hydrologic & hydraulic Distributed RUnoff Model (K-DRUM),can simulate temporal changes and the spatial distribution of flood discharge by taking into consideration radar grid rainfall and grid based hydrological parameters. The model was applied to the Geum River Basin, which include the Yongdam and Daecheong Dam Watersheds located on the Korean Peninsula. The results were calculated between a single domain and a divided small domain. They were compared to analyze the application effects of the parallelization technique. As a result, a maximum of 10 times the amount of calculation time was saved by using parallelization code rather than a single processor. Also, problems related to the running time and inaccurate settings that typically occurred using the existing trial and error method were solved by applying an auto calibration method in setting initial soil moisture conditions. As the result, the calculation results showed a good agreement with the observed data.

        原 咸北 慶興地域語 ‘N하다’, ‘N을 하다’의 聲調와 ‘N하다’ 構成의 形態論的 解釋

        박진혁 한국어문교육연구회 2008 어문연구(語文硏究) Vol.36 No.4

        The first aim of this paper is to examine and describe the tone of ‘N-hada’ and ‘N-eul hada’ in original Gyeong-Heung Dialect in Hamgyeong Province of Korea. Several tonal patterns of ‘N-hada’ and ‘N-eul hada’ are used for interpreting the Morphological structure of ‘N-hada’. The result of comparing several tonal patterns of ‘N-hada’ and ‘N-eul hada’ is that the structure of ‘N-hada’ and that of ‘N-eul hada’ is heterogeneous. So examining that the result and ‘the Constraint of Surface Tonal Sequence’ in this dialect, I discriminate ‘N-hada’ as a morphological ‘word’. ‘N-hada’ is not a syntactic structure(‘phrase’). The next aim is to discriminate the type of word formation (compound or derivative) of ‘N-hada’, because ‘N-hada’ is a complex word. So I compare the several tonal patterns of ‘N-hada’ and those of the compound and derivative words in this dialect. The result is that the several tonal patterns of ‘N-hada’ and compound word(‘NV’ type) is homogeneous, but those of ‘N-hada’ and derivative word is not. Therefore, I discriminate ‘N-hada’ as a compound word. 本稿에서는 原 咸北 慶興地域語에서 確認되는 ‘N하다’ 및 ‘N을 하다’ 構成의 聲調 實現 樣相을 檢討함으로써 이 지역어 ‘N하다’ 構成의 形態論的 解釋을 試圖해 보았다. 이 지역어의 ‘N하다’와 ‘N을 하다’의 聲調 實現 樣相을 比較한 결과 두 構成은 서로 異質的인 것으로 나타났다. 本稿에서는 이를 이 지역어의 ‘表面聲調 配列 制約’과 연관 지어 검토하여, ‘N하다’를 統辭 構成이 아닌 形態論的 單語로 判別하였다. ‘N하다’가 ‘單語’라고 할 때, 이는 ‘複合語complex’이므로 그 語形成 類型의 判別이 필요하다. 本稿에서는 ‘N하다’의 合成語, 派生語 與否를 判別하기 위하여 이 지역어의 일반적인 合成語, 派生語 聲調 實現 樣相과 ‘N하다’의 聲調를 比較하는 方法을 택하였다. 그 결과 이 지역어의 ‘N하다’는 聲調 實現 면에서 派生語와 상당히 異質的인 반면, ‘NV’류 合成語와는 同質的인 것으로 나타났다.

        A Study on the Comparative Method Using AHP and GIS Based Distributed Runoff Model

        박진혁 대한토목학회 2010 KSCE JOURNAL OF CIVIL ENGINEERING Vol.14 No.6

        Research in the field of river hydrology has been mainly concerned with the investigation of the rainfall-runoff phenomenon through the analysis of hydrological factors such as meteorology and geography, with the focus being on each river basin. Recently,various forms of digital information such as GIS (Geographic Information System) and RS (Remote Sensing) data have been made available in worldwide digital map format. Therefore, there has been a shift in focus from lumped-parameter models to distributed runoff models, as the latter can consider temporal and spatial variations in water quantity. Distributed runoff models have made possible the comparison of runoff field and rainfall-runoff characteristics considering spatial distribution. Hydrological conditions are differently distributed regionally or nationally, and each river basin has unique characteristics. The main purpose of this study is to compare hydrological characteristics in several river basins and methodologies by using a GIS based distributed runoff model and AHP (Analytic Hierarchy Process) for the analysis of river basins based on their regional hydrological characteristics and considering their temporally and spatially-distributed physical properties is proposed. Based on the methods, the main purpose of this study, as proposed is to clearly identify the characteristics and similarities for each river basin so that we can understand the differences and similarities of river basin characteristics quantitatively and to provide objective criteria for the characteristics of each river basin as a basic study on comparative hydrology. An application of the comparative hydrology approach is presented for the comparison of three river basins located in the Asian-Pacific region.
